Professor Wang is an Assistant professor at Stanford's Center for Computer Research in Music and Acoustics (CCRMA, pronounced as "Karma"), Department of Music, and Computer Science by Courtesy. He is also the CTO of the company, Smule. The iPad just came out this past weekend, and coincidentally in his first radio performance, Professor Wang kindly played several piano tracks using his iPad as an instrument.
He also played pieces on his iPhone using the app, Ocarina. In this interview, Professor Wang talks of his work/love (they're one in the same) for music and computers.
Professor Wang also talks about the Stanford Laptop Orchestra whose members include those from a seminar he teaches called, "Music 128" "CS 170." SLOrk will perform a free concert on Thursday April 29, 2010 at 8 p.m. Please check their website for information.
